Frank Skinner’s Poetry Podcast returns for new series

Following the success of the past two series, comedian and Absolute Radio presenter Frank Skinner is returning with Season Three of his Poetry Podcast, launching today, 19 May.

During the podcast Frank takes a humorous look at some of his favourite pieces of poetry, as well as sharing some of his new discoveries.

This season will be the longest yet with eight new episodes, with more poems and poets to uncover. Among those Frank will be discussing are an all-time favourite of his, the Star-Splitter by the legendary American poet Robert Frost and his new lockdown discovery, English poet Ella Frears.

Passionate about poetry, Frank brings his own personal experiences, wry wit and observations to each poem. Previous series have looked at William Wordsworth, Rita Dove, Philip Larkin, Tadeusz Dabrowski and Cathy Park Hong.

Frank said: “The third series includes some of my favourite poetry of all time and also stuff I’ve only recently discovered and have become infatuated with. So, you know when you have a late-night conversation with a friend who tells you amazing tales about their old flames, some you knew and some you never met, and then becomes positively feverish when they talk about their latest love? It’s like that. But about poetry.”

Frank’s enthusiasm for poetry has been so infectious across the last two series that the podcast has reignited many listeners’ own love for poems, sending them back to read work they haven’t looked at since school, as well as seeking out new pieces.
